Summary, etc.: | One of the world's greatest novelists, Leo Tolstoy was also the author of a number of superb short stories, one of his best known being "The Kreutzer Sonata." This macabre story involves the murder of a wife by her husband. It is a penetrating study of jealousy as well as a piercing complaint about the way in which society educates men and women in matters of sex-a serious condemnation of the mores and attitudes of the wealthy, educated class. |
